Wikipedia has become a staple in internet research - for quick information it's the place to go. The internet encyclopedia is unique in the sense that the public has the opportunity to amend, correct and add to the entries. Yet, this week contributions from the Los Angeles branch of Scientology were blocked because members were revising entries with a “pro-scientology” viewpoint. Mangers also blocked some critics of the religion from editing entries. The crack down has caused a stir in the cyber community. Is Wikipedia stepping on free speech or is this just an attempt at net "neutrality?"
